Everyone knows I'm the most right wing conservative you'll come across. However, let me point out that the cops were undercover cops, meaning (most likely) no visable badges at the time of the incident. Therefore, this black kid is in a bad part of town and a bunch of unknown guys start following him, then they draw guns, and then start shooting. All the kid knows is he's being shot at -- -- most likely by gang bangers; he doesn't realize they are the police. In that context, his conduct was reasonable: He was unarmed and he was trying to escape.
When I was a prosecutor in the U.S. Navy, one of the things we always made sure of was that Shore Patrol personnel (i.e. military police) on patrol had their SP insignia plainly visable on their uniforms and were wearing white SP helmets, thereby indicating their police function. If they didn't, the jerk resisting arrest or running away couldn't be prosecuted for resisting arrest or running from the Shore Patrol because he wouldn't know they were SPs. If the NY undercover cops didn't make it clear to the kid who was shot that they were undercover cops, the kid is innocent and the cops are in the wrong. And if that's the case, they all need to be taken off the force and maybe prosecuted. I think Jessee Jackson and Al Sharpton are a couple of the biggest jerks on the planet. But this time, they may be right. This kid may be an innocent victim of criminally incompetent undercover work. George SSSS |
